In Endpoint file system in Discover Targets, we tried to filter a IP address of a Endpoint machine. "Include Filter" seems not work (Number of files scanned is "0") but "Exclude Filter" is functionable. Pls advise.
And how can we know to scan which the endpoint machine?

when you run an Endpoint scan, it runs on all endpoints. you can exclude any computers you wish from it.
All the computers will be scanned unless suggested otherwise.
